Expression and clinical significance of PUMA gene in salivary adenoid cystic carcinoma

2016 
PURPOSE: To explore the expression of p53 up-regulated modulator of apoptosis (PUMA) gene in salivary adenoid cystic carcinoma (SACC) and its clinical significance. METHODS: The expressions of PUMA gene and protein were detected in 27 SACC tumor-adjacent tissues (group A) and 27 SACC tumor tissues (group B) with real-time quantitative PCR and Western blot. Statistical analysis was performed using SPSS 19.0 software package. RESULTS: The expression of PUMA gene in groups A as calibrator was 1,and expression of PUMA gene in group B was 0.57±0.17. The expression of PUMA protein in groups A and B were 0.94±0.12 and 0.36±0.12,respectively. The expressions of PUMA gene and protein were significantly lower in group B than in group A (P<0.05). CONCLUSIONS: The expression of puma gene in SACC tissues is down-regulated, which is negatively correlated with the development of SACC.
